Abstract: The present invention relates to a composite negative electrode active material comprising: silicon-based oxide particles; and a metal distributed on the surface, inside, or on the surface and inside of the silicon-based oxide particles, wherein the average diameter of aggregates, as obtained by a specific method, is 65 nm or less. The composite negative electrode active material has a uniform and small aggregate diameter, and thus deterioration in the lifespan performance of the composite negative electrode active material, which is affected by the volumetric expansion and contraction of silicon during charging and discharging, can be minimized.
